Subject: Re: [security-services] comments re sstc-saml-holder-of-key-browser-sso-draft-10
On Tue, Jan 6, 2009 at 1:03 PM, Scott Cantor <cantor.2@osu.edu> wrote: > >> If the choice is arbitrary, then I see no point of allowing multiple >> elements to begin with. Unless there is a possible use case, no >> matter how far fetched, I suggest we restrict ourselves to one and >> only one AuthnStatement. > > I think the primary issue is that if you include multiple assertions that > relate to other profiles, some of them are likely to have authentication > statements (in most cases identical ones). I don't think you can have a rule > that says only one statement can appear across all of them. Okay then, I'll leave multiple AuthnStatements in the spec but leave the processing of multiple AuthnStatements unspecified. Thanks, Tom
